OTHM Level 4 Certificate in Leading the Internal Quality Assurance of Assessment Processes and Practice
This qualification develops learners' understanding of theory and practice in quality assurance roles in education, enabling them to work effectively and lead internal quality assurance teams.

Course Features
This UK-regulated qualification combines theoretical knowledge with practical application, preparing learners to lead internal quality assurance activities and maintain assessment standards across education and training settings.
- Regulated by Ofqual (UK) with qualification number 603/5202/4
- 18 credits with 180 hours Total Qualification Time
- 3 mandatory units covering IQA principles, practice, and leadership
- Internally assessed by centres and externally verified by OTHM
- Criterion-referenced assessment based on learning outcomes
- Progression pathways to Level 5 qualifications and university programmes

What You'll Learn
This qualification develops learners' knowledge and understanding of internal quality assurance principles, practical IQA skills, and leadership capabilities for managing work in their area of responsibility.
- Understand the context, principles, and functions of internal quality assurance in learning and development
- Plan and prepare internal quality assurance activities and develop comprehensive IQA plans
- Evaluate assessment quality using specified criteria and ensure assessment methods are safe, fair, valid, and reliable
- Provide feedback, advice, and support to assessors to maintain and improve assessment quality
- Apply procedures for standardising assessment practices and ensuring consistency of assessor decisions
- Plan, allocate, and monitor work in own area of responsibility with team members

Course Requirements
OTHM does not specify formal entry requirements for this qualification but ensures learners have sufficient capability to undertake the learning and assessment.
- Minimum age of 18 years
- English language competency if not from a majority English-speaking country
Assessments
All units are internally assessed by centres and externally verified by OTHM using criterion-referenced assessment based on achievement of specified learning outcomes.
- Written assignments and essays for knowledge-based units
- Portfolio of evidence including reflective accounts of work
- Observation of performance in real work settings
- Work products such as IQA plans, monitoring records, and sign-off forms
